
Explore the evolution of sci-fi from its origins as a small genre with a cult following to the blockbuster pop-cultural phenomenon we know today. In each episode, James Cameron introduces one of the “Big Questions” that humankind has contemplated throughout the ages and reaches back into sci-fi’s past to better understand how our favorite films, TV shows, books, and video games were born.


From its earliest days, science fiction has asked whether or not we're alone in the universe. Steven Spielberg, Ridley Scott, Sigourney Weaver and others ponder the question: What can aliens teach us about ourselves?
George Lucas, Zoe Saldana, Jeff Goldblum and others imagine what waits in outer space -- and how will those discoveries change who humans are.
Guillermo del Toro, Ridley Scott, Milla Jovovich and others explore what terrifies people about monsters and why they like being scared so much.
Steven Spielberg, Christopher Nolan, Robert Kirkman and others explore how humans will survive when the world goes to hell.
Technology is at the heart of science fiction. Steven Spielberg, Arnold Schwarzenegger, George Lucas and others attempt to answer the question: Will the smart machines that science fiction predicted save humankind or lead to our demise?
Christopher Nolan, Keanu Reeves, Christopher Lloyd and others look at how time travel can correct history's mistakes while creating new ones.
